Best Games apps for iPad
1. Word Solitaire HD (free)
If you prefer a more sedate and cerebral challenge, Word Solitaire is a good choice. Like a cross between scrabble and solitaire, Word Solitaire requires you to form words with the cards available to you. The aim is to uncover and use all the cards. It’s well paced and there are literally hundreds of levels to work through so this will keep you occupied for a long time.
2. Fieldrunners for iPad (£4.99)
One of the best of the so-called ‘tower defence’ genre of games, Fieldrunners charges you with stopping a series of bad guys from crossing the screen. You have a variety of weapons at your disposal and need to create mazes and obstacles in order to succeed. It’s an addictive game that quickly becomes a real challenge.
3. Plants vs Zombies HD (£3.99)
The zombie apocalypse has begun and the only thing stopping the undead reaching your house is your army of deadly plants. Deploy them on your lawn, in your swimming pool and even on your roof as wave after wave of zombies attempts to breach your defences. Plants vs Zombies blends great gameplay with a smart sense of humour.

4. Real Racing 2 HD (£5.99)
If you want to be amazed by just how much the iPad can deliver, Real Racing 2 HD is an ideal game to check out. This deep and detailed racing game has brilliant graphics that look even better on the more powerful iPad 2. It’s not just fun for a quick race – there’s plenty in here to keep you coming back.
5. Infinity Blade (£1.79)
Another title that shows off the iPad’s graphics, Infinity Blade looks astonishing and its gameplay is wonderfully designed for the touchscreen. It’s a sword fighting game that has you slashing and swiping your fingers across the screen as you battle your way into a castle.
6. Football Manager 2011 (£6.99)
For almost 20 years the Football Manager series has obsessed video gamers. The latest computer version of the game is almost mind-bogglingly detailed but there’s an awful lot packed into this more casual version too. Recently upgraded for the iPad’s larger screen, Football Manager 2011 means that your quest for footballing glory can go on wherever you are.
